Каким образом цифровые решения осуществляют тестирование надежности

Каким образом цифровые решения осуществляют тестирование надежности

Современная создание программного обеспечения немыслима без системной структуры контроля надежности. Каждый период огромное количество юзеров взаимодействуют с разнообразными приложениями, интернет-платформами и цифровыми решениями, требуя от них надежной деятельности, секьюрности и соблюдения объявленному опциям. Система поддержания надежности технических разработок являет собой комплексную методологию тестирования, анализа и мониторинга, которая обеспечивает продукт на каждом стадиях его развития.

Что точно считают стандартом в технических продуктах

Стандарт ПО ап икс устанавливается множеством критериев, которые в совокупности определяют потребительский опыт и техническую надежность разработки. Функциональность составляет главным показателем – приложение должна реализовывать все указанные возможности в соответственности с системными спецификациями и ожиданиями пользователей.

Стабильность технического разработки выражается в его возможности работать без неполадок в многочисленных ситуациях использования. Это охватывает сопротивляемость к внезапным информации, адекватную обработку некорректных обстоятельств и способность возвращаться после кратковременных проблем. Быстродействие показывает скорость осуществления процессов, длительность ответа системы на клиентские операции и эффективность использования компьютерных ресурсов.

Простота применения устанавливает, насколько интуитивно понятным и комфортным оказывается взаимодействие с программой для итоговых клиентов. Туда относятся удобство взаимодействия ап икс, понятность перемещения, возможность для лиц с специальными потребностями и совокупная простота изучения функционала.

Поддерживаемость технического кода сказывается на возможность его последующего развития и поддержки. Грамотно написанный скрипт обязан быть читаемым, модульным, хорошо описанным и структурированным подобным способом, чтобы иные разработчики были способны легко в нем понять и внести нужные модификации.

Как тестируют, что всё работает по спецификациям

Проверка согласованности технического решения требованиям инициируется с скрупулезного исследования спецификаций и функциональных требований. Группа проверки формирует подробные проверки, которые охватывают все описанные в материалах случаи использования программы up x. Любой тест-кейс включает ясные шаги для повторения, планируемые выводы и параметры успешного завершения тестирования.

Таблица трассируемости условий способствует удостовериться, что каждое спецификация покрыто релевантными проверками, а всякий проверка связан с специфическим требованием. Это обеспечивает исключить ситуаций, когда критически важная функциональность остается нетестированной или когда используется время на проверку несуществующих условий.

Приемочное испытание выполняется с вовлечением заказчиков или участников отделов, которые наиболее точно представляют, как программа должна действовать в практических ситуациях. Они контролируют не только технологическую правильность воплощения, но и совместимость деловым операциям и клиентским предположениям.

Возвратное испытание гарантирует, что свежие изменения в системе не сломали ранее действовавший возможности. После любого обновления или исправления ошибок активируется набор тестов, проверяющих главные операции системы.

Почему проверка инициируется еще до создания скрипта

Современный подход к поддержанию качества подразумевает деятельное вовлечение экспертов по тестированию на первоначальных этапах программы:

  • Исследование условий дает возможность обнаружить погрешности, несоответствия и пробелы в технических требованиях до инициирования разработки.
  • Создание проверочных вариантов содействует полнее осознать планируемое функционирование системы и уточнить подробности выполнения.
  • Подготовка тестовых материалов и проверочной структуры экономит период на последующих этапах.
  • Планирование методологии тестирования устанавливает необходимые средства и сроки для надежной контроля.
  • Создание программных тестов может инициироваться параллельно с разработкой главного кода.

Данный способ, знакомый как «перенос влево» в тестировании, заметно сокращает цену исправления дефектов, так как их выявление и ликвидация на ранних стадиях нуждается минимальных расходов периода и средств. Дополнительно, начальное включение тестировщиков в ход способствует формированию совместного понимания проекта у полной коллектива разработки ап икс официальный сайт.

Которые виды проверок используют: вручную и программно

Мануальное проверка продолжает быть уникальным инструментом для контроля клиентского опыта, экспериментального испытания и тестирования многоуровневых деловых случаев. Тестировщики исполняют роль конечных юзеров, работая с системой через визуальный взаимодействие и оценивая комфорт эксплуатации, логичность работы и совместимость надеждам.

Экспериментальное проверка обеспечивает найти непредвиденные дефекты и сложности, которые не были учтены в стандартных сценариях. Квалифицированные тестировщики задействуют свое знание сферы и техническую интуицию для нахождения возможных уязвимостей в программе.

Программное проверка эффективно для проверки повторяющихся вариантов, повторного тестирования и анализа крупных количеств информации. Программные испытания могут запускаться круглосуточно, не предполагают вовлечения человека и предоставляют стабильные результаты контроля.

Модульное проверка проверяет индивидуальные компоненты приложения up x в отдельности от другой программы. Разработчики формируют тесты для своего скрипта, которые запускаются при всяком изменении и помогают быстро находить проблемы на этапе отдельных функций или категорий.

Совместное тестирование сосредотачивается на контроле контакта между различными компонентами и частями программы. Оно способствует обнаружить неполадки в связях, пересылке информации между частями и совокупной архитектуре решения.

Как обнаруживают баги на разных фазах разработки

На фазе планирования и создания неточности находятся через анализ технических условий, исследование архитектурных подходов и имитацию пользовательских ситуаций. Эксперты отличающихся профилей изучают бумаги, выявляют возможные проблемы и советуют усовершенствования до начала интенсивной программирования.

Во период создания скрипта разработчики применяют статический изучение кода, который автоматически проверяет приложение ап икс официальный сайт на соответствие правилам кодирования, потенциальные проблемы защиты и типичные дефекты программирования. Актуальные объединенные среды разработки включают средства, которые выделяют сложности сразу в ходе создания кода.

Анализ программы составляет собой процесс взаимной проверки скрипта кодерами. Товарищи анализируют созданный скрипт с позиции логики функционирования, согласованности правилам коллектива, возможных неполадок быстродействия и возможностей для оптимизации. Этот ход не только помогает обнаружить ошибки, но и помогает обмену опытом в коллективе.

Активное испытание выполняется на функционирующей системе и содержит разнообразные разновидности рабочего и вспомогательного проверки. Специалисты активируют приложение с разными входными данными, проверяют функционирование в граничных ситуациях и изучают результаты реализации.

Почему критично контролировать безопасность и оборону материалов

Секьюрность программных продуктов up x является критически важным элементом стандарта в период цифровизации и возрастающих киберугроз. Компрометация защиты могут привести не только к финансовым потерям, но и к критическому урону престижу компании, утрате уверенности покупателей и юридическим последствиям.

Проверка защищенности содержит проверку аутентификации и доступа юзеров, обороны от ключевых типов нападений, таких как SQL-инъекции, кросс-сайтовое программирование и подделка межсайтовых обращений. Профессионалы по секьюрности изучают структуру системы с перспективы возможных опасностей и тестируют эффективность реализованных охранных механизмов.

Оборона персональных данных требует особого внимания в связи с ужесточением правовых норм в области приватности. Программы обязаны корректно управлять, хранить и транспортировать чувствительную информацию, обеспечивать возможность удаления материалов по просьбе клиентов и придерживаться основы сокращения получения данных.

Криптографическая оборона информации ап икс контролируется на предмет применения новейших методов кодирования, корректной выполнения стандартов безопасности и адекватного управления паролями. Уязвимости в защите могут сделать всю структуру защиты малорезультативной.

Как контролируют темп, загрузку и надежность

Производительность софта проверяется через систему стрессовых тестов, которые моделируют многочисленные сценарии применения системы в действительных обстоятельствах. Нагрузочное проверка определяет, как приложение функционирует при предполагаемом количестве клиентов и процессов.

Экстремальное испытание содействует найти момент отказа программы, постепенно увеличивая загрузку до максимальных параметров. Это позволяет понять границы потенциала приложения и проверить, как адекватно она снижается при чрезмерной нагрузке.

Проверка стабильности содержит длительные тестирование работы системы ап икс официальный сайт под постоянной напряжением для нахождения потерь данных, поэтапного снижения быстродействия и других сложностей, которые выражаются только при длительной деятельности.

Отслеживание эффективности во момент проверки содержит контроль задействования CPU, памяти, хранилища и сетевых возможностей. Эти метрики помогают найти проблемные зоны в архитектуре и улучшить производительность приложения.

Что предпринимают, если ошибка выявлена перед запуском

Обнаружение ошибки перед релизом решения инициирует процедуру оценки важности проблемы и принятия выбора о будущих действиях. Серьезные дефекты, которые могут вызвать к потере информации, нарушению безопасности или тотальной неисправности системы, предполагают экстренного коррекции.

Процедура контроля ошибками содержит подробное документирование обнаруженной неполадки с обозначением шагов для повторения, условий, в где демонстрируется баг, и предполагаемого поведения приложения. Отдел разработки изучает ошибку, выявляет основание и планирует коррекцию.

Ранжирование коррекций основывается на эффекте ошибки на юзеров ап икс, частоте ее демонстрации и комплексности исправления. Отдельные незначительные сложности могут быть отложены до следующего выпуска, если их устранение требует значительных корректировок в программе.

После коррекции дефекта выполняется проверочное тестирование, которое удостоверяет, что проблема устранена, а также регрессионное проверка для проверки того, что исправление не привело к появлению дополнительных дефектов в других частях системы.